Global Solar Vehicle Market Insights

Global Solar Vehicle Market size was valued at USD 360 million in 2022 and is poised to grow from USD 432.36 million in 2023 to USD 1871.50 million by 2031, growing at a CAGR of 20.10% during the forecast period (2024-2031).

The global solar vehicle market is experiencing significant growth and has emerged as a promising alternative to traditional fossil fuel-powered vehicles. Solar vehicles utilize solar energy to generate electricity, which powers their propulsion systems. This clean and renewable energy source reduces greenhouse gas emissions and dependence on fossil fuels, making solar vehicles an environmentally friendly transportation solution. One of the key factors driving the growth of the global solar vehicle market is the increasing awareness of climate change and the need for sustainable transportation options. Governments and regulatory bodies across the world are implementing stringent emission standards and offering incentives to promote the adoption of solar vehicles. This has led to a rise in research and development activities, technological advancements, and increased investments in the solar vehicle sector. The market is witnessing a range of solar-powered vehicles, including solar cars, solar buses, and solar-powered bikes. Solar cars, in particular, are gaining popularity due to their improved efficiency, longer driving ranges, and better battery technologies. Companies and startups are actively developing innovative designs and materials to enhance the performance and aesthetics of solar vehicles. Although the solar vehicle market still faces challenges such as high costs, limited infrastructure, and technological limitations, ongoing advancements in solar technology and favorable government policies are expected to drive market growth in the coming years. Furthermore, collaborations between automobile manufacturers, solar panel manufacturers, and energy companies are helping to accelerate the development and adoption of solar vehicles.

Solar Vehicle Market Analysis by Type

By type, the market can be segmented into passenger vehicles, and commercial vehicles. Passenger vehicles dominated the solar vehicle market. Solar-powered cars and solar-powered SUVs designed for personal transportation have gained significant traction and consumer interest. The growing concern for environmental sustainability, coupled with the rising demand for electric vehicles, has contributed to the dominance of this segment.

Commercial vehicles, including solar-powered buses, trucks, delivery vans, and other utility vehicles, represent the fastest growing segment in the solar vehicle market. The increasing need for sustainable logistics, public transportation, and efficient fleet operations has propelled the growth of solar-powered commercial vehicles.

Solar Vehicle Market Analysis by Application

By application, the market can be segmented into personal use and fleet operations. The personal use segment dominated the solar vehicle market. Solar-powered vehicles designed for personal transportation, such as solar cars and solar SUVs, have gained significant popularity among environmentally conscious consumers. Growing concerns about climate change and the need to reduce greenhouse gas emissions have led to a surge in demand for eco-friendly transportation options. Solar vehicles offer a sustainable alternative to conventional gasoline-powered cars, enabling individuals to reduce their carbon footprint and contribute to a cleaner environment.

Fleet operations represent the fastest growing segment in the solar vehicle market. This segment includes solar-powered vehicles deployed by commercial fleet operators, ride-sharing companies, logistics providers, and public transportation agencies. As businesses increasingly prioritize sustainability, solar vehicles offer an attractive solution for reducing carbon emissions in logistics operations. Solar-powered commercial vehicles can help fleet operators meet sustainability targets, comply with emission regulations, and enhance their brand image by showcasing their commitment to environmental responsibility.

Global Solar Vehicle Market Regional Insights

Asia-Pacific (APAC) dominated the global solar vehicle market. The region has witnessed significant growth and holds a substantial share in terms of both production and consumption of solar vehicles. Countries like China, Japan, and South Korea are at the forefront of solar vehicle development and adoption in the APAC region. China, in particular, has emerged as a dominant player in the solar vehicle market. The country's government has implemented favorable policies, such as subsidies and tax incentives, to promote the use of solar vehicles. China's strong manufacturing capabilities and a large domestic market have contributed to its leadership position in the solar vehicle industry.

North America is experiencing rapid growth and is considered the fastest growing region in the global solar vehicle market. The United States, in particular, is witnessing significant advancements in solar vehicle technology and a growing interest in sustainable transportation options. The U.S. government has implemented various initiatives to promote the adoption of solar vehicles, including tax credits, grants, and research funding. Several states in the U.S., such as California, have set ambitious targets for electric and solar vehicle sales, driving the demand in the market.

Solar Vehicle Market Restraints

High initial cost associated with solar vehicle technology

  • One major restraint hindering the growth of the global solar vehicle market is the high initial cost associated with solar vehicle technology. Solar vehicles require specialized components, such as high-efficiency solar panels and advanced energy storage systems, which can significantly increase the overall cost of the vehicle. Additionally, the limited availability of charging infrastructure for solar vehicles poses a challenge for widespread adoption. The high upfront investment and the need for supportive infrastructure may deter potential buyers from opting for solar vehicles, slowing down the market growth to some extent.

Solar Vehicle Market Recent Developments

  • In May 2023, Chinese electric vehicle startup NIO announced a collaboration with solar panel manufacturer JA Solar to develop lightweight and flexible solar panels for integration into NIO's electric vehicles.
  • In April 2023, American electric vehicle manufacturer Lucid Motors secured $4.6 billion in funding to expand production capacity and further develop its solar-powered luxury electric vehicles.
  • In February 2023, German automaker Volkswagen announced a strategic partnership with solar panel manufacturer Hanwha Q Cells to develop solar charging solutions for Volkswagen's electric vehicle lineup.
  • In October 2022, Swedish electric vehicle manufacturer Polestar unveiled its first solar-powered concept car, showcasing its commitment to sustainable mobility and renewable energy integration.
  • In August 2022, Chinese ride-hailing giant Didi Chuxing partnered with electric vehicle manufacturer BYD to launch a fleet of solar-powered electric cars for its ride-sharing platform in selected cities.
